Igwesi is a young dynamic politician who within the shorl time of&#8217;4&#8217;1&#8242; Republic gained wide experience of membership ofthe two Houses ofAssembly. He has represented Nkanu West State Constituency at the Enugu State House ofAssembly and gone over to Abuja to represent the Federal Constituency at the National Assembly. In both places, he has shown maturity and sense of good leadership expected ol&#8221; those able to pilot the affairs ofthe great nation. lion Igwesi has a very big sympathy for the poor and has for long stood for the policies that will totally eradicate poverty from the Oil Rich Nation. Nigeria. Education \u2022 Enugu State University of Science and Technology, B.Sc Hons. \u2022 University of Nigeria. Nsukka M.Sc Work Experience \u2022 SlaffENDEP-amedia outfit \u2022 Rose to the position of Manager ol&#8221; ENDEP- State Media Organization. \u2022 Decided to go into Politics- \u2022 Joined PDP- People&#8217;s Democratic Party \u2022 Contested a seat for the Enugu Stale House ofAssembly and won in 1999 \u2022 Elecied Majority Leader at the Slate House ofAssembly. \u2022 Proved a brilliant resourceful Leader and a transparently honest man. Performed brilliantly between 1999 and 2003 \u2022 (iot another mandate to represent now the entire Nkanu East and Nkanu West Federal Constituency at the National Assembly where he is now as the Representative ofthe people. \u2022 Ile throws in his weight behind every programme that will enhance the Igbo Cause and he is a committed Igbo patriot. Community Development \u2022 Sponsored many indigent students in school \u2022 Ilas contributed to local development projects. He isanauthority inthe Maritime Sector ofNigerian Economy. Meanwhile, heis the chairman ofa large indigenous shipping company. Genesis Worldwide Shipping Limited. He is anemployer ol&#8221; labour, a shrewd business strategist and a hard working man who has set a pace in the shipping industry in the West African Sub region. Born in the 1950s. Captain Iheanacho began his business enterprise in the 1970s as a Custom Officer when he had the privilege lo go on board as a Boarding Oliicer. That experience built upa strong interest in him. Heexplored thepossibilities ol&#8221; carving a niche for himselfthrough that experience. In 1972. he served as a Deck Officer Cadet and in 1982. having passed through the ranks, he attained the position of a Master Mariner and later appointed as a Captain in 1984. Career History \u2022 Passed through all the cadres and attained the zenith in his career in Merchant Navy \u2022 Tooka job in the UK as a Corporate Planning Executive, United Kingdom WestAfrican Conference. \u2022 Launched into private business and established Genesis Worldwide Shipping Ltd- a shipping company that started with no ship but today has a licet of ships. His shipping outfit is the most viable totally controlled by Nigerians. Education and Training \u2022 Formal qualification, as professional Master Mariner \u2022 M.Sc in International Transport from the University ol&#8221; Wales \u2022 MBA in General Management from university of Bradford Contributions in the Profession and Society \u2022 Developed Maritime Operations- ethics, administration, operational systems, etc \u2022 Contributed much to the Cabotage Law as he has delivered many papers in support of it. \u2022 Encouraged and advocated for more Nigerian participation in Maritime industry as stake holders not as job seeker for foreign entrepreneurs \u2022 Member of Peoples Democratic Party (PDP). contested in the Senate election but lost to late Senator Amah Iwuagwu who died in 2005. He still believes that the destiny ol&#8217;the country lies in the hands ofthe citizens. Business Promotion \u2022 Diversification into Oil and Gas Sectors He is an Icon of Industrial Efficiency and professional excellence.
